FAQs

  • Do you upload my files?
    No. Editing happens entirely in your browser.
  • What file formats are supported?
    Import SRT; export SRT and VTT. UTF‑8 encoding recommended.
  • How do overlap fixes work?
    Click “Detect & fix overlaps” to review suggested nudges or merges before applying them.
  • Can I jump to a specific timestamp?
    Use the Go to time field (HH:MM:SS,mmm) or press ⌘/Ctrl + G to highlight the nearest cue.
  • Keyboard shortcuts?
    Open the Shortcuts panel (⌘/Ctrl + /) for the full list. Highlights include ⌘/Ctrl + ⌥/Alt + ←/→ to nudge cues and ⌘/Ctrl + S to export.
  • What does "Merge close cues" do?
    Combines cues with gaps ≤200ms between them. Respects industry standards: max 84 characters, 7 seconds duration, and 20 characters-per-second reading speed.
  • What does "Split long cues" do?
    Splits cues >84 characters at sentence boundaries. Timing is proportional to text length with 1-second minimum per part.
